What is the effect of a well-organized classroom environment on students?

A well-organized classroom environment significantly contributes to enhanced learning for students. When the physical setup is structured and resources are readily accessible, it fosters a sense of safety and stability. Students are better able to focus on the lesson at hand without unnecessary distractions, which is crucial for absorbing and retaining information.

In such an environment, teachers can efficiently manage classroom activities, allowing students to maximize their participation and engagement. This setup promotes clear communication and effective collaboration among students, further enriching the learning experience. Consequently, when students feel secure and supported by their surroundings, they are more likely to take risks, ask questions, and engage deeply with the material. Thus, a well-organized classroom serves as a foundation for productive learning experiences.
